Democrat Joe Biden was heckled for leaving Americans stranded in Afghanistan as he surveyed the damage from Hurricane Ida in New Jersey.

During a visit to a neighborhood in Manville, Biden faced fire from angry onlookers who reminded him about his botched handling of the U.S. military withdrawal from Afghanistan.
One woman yelled off-camera:
"My country is going to s--- and you're allowing it!"

"And I’m an immigrant, and I’m proud of this country! I’d give my life for this country."
"You guys should be ashamed of yourselves."
"All this for a f--- photo-op?" one man scoffed off camera.
"You ain't gonna do s---!"
"My best friend died in 2011 in Afghanistan for what?" another man shouted.
"For this guy to pull this s---? You leave them in ruins and leave Americans behind!"

"He will leave you behind – you guys protecting him," he said to the police officers assisting Biden.
"Leave no American behind!" another woman screamed.
Biden appeared to be oblivious to the hecklers.
Even Democrats are slamming Biden's "delays and inaction" on rescuing stranded Americans from Taliban-controlled Afghanistan.
Sen. Dick Blumenthal (D-CT) says he is "furious" at the Biden administration's lack of effort in getting hundreds of U.S. citizens safely out of the country.
On Monday, Blumenthal, who sits on the Senate Armed Services Committee, released a statement expressing his frustration and anger toward the Democrat regime leader.
"I have been deeply frustrated, even furious, at our government's delay and inaction," Blumenthal said.
